"use strict"; var redis = require('redis'); function initClient(options) { var auth = options.auth; var redisUrl = options.url; var client; options.port = options.port || 6379; // 6379 is Redis' default options.host = options.host || '127.0.0.1'; if (!redisUrl) { client = redis.createClient(options); } else { client = redis.createClient(redisUrl, options); } if(auth){ client.auth(auth); } return client; } /** * Create a new NodeRedisPubsub instance that can subscribe to channels and publish messages * @param {Object} options Options for the client creations: * port - Optional, the port on which the Redis server is launched. * scope - Optional, two NodeRedisPubsubs with different scopes will not share messages * emitter - Optional, a redis or reds_io client * receiver - Optionla, a redis or reds_io client * url - Optional, a correctly formed redis connection url */ function NodeRedisPubsub(options){ if (!(this instanceof NodeRedisPubsub)){ return new NodeRedisPubsub(options); } options || (options = {}); // accept connections / clients having the same interface as node_redis clients // Need to create two Redis clients as one cannot be both in receiver and emitter mode // I wonder why that is, by the way ... if(options.emitter) { this.emitter = options.emitter; } else { this.emitter = initClient(options); } if(options.receiver) { this.receiver = options.receiver; } else { this.receiver = initClient(options); this.receiver.setMaxListeners(0); } delete options.url; this.prefix = options.scope ? options.scope + ':' : ''; } /** * Return the emitter object to be used as a regular redis client to save resources. */ NodeRedisPubsub.prototype.getRedisClient = function(){ return this.emitter; }; /** * Subscribe to a channel * @param {String} channel The channel to subscribe to, can be a pattern e.g. 'user.*' * @param {Function} handler Function to call with the received message. * @param {Function} cb Optional callback to call once the handler is registered. * */ NodeRedisPubsub.prototype.on = NodeRedisPubsub.prototype.subscribe = function(channel, handler, callback){ if(!callback) callback = function(){}; var self = this; if(channel === "error"){ self.errorHandler = handler; this.emitter.on("error", handler); this.receiver.on("error", handler); callback(); return; } var pmessageHandler = function(pattern, _channel, message){ if(self.prefix + channel === pattern){ var jsonmsg = message; try{ jsonmsg = JSON.parse(message); } catch (ex){ if(typeof self.errorHandler === 'function'){ return self.errorHandler("Invalid JSON received! Channel: " + self.prefix + channel + " Message: " + message); } } return handler(jsonmsg, _channel); } }; this.receiver.on('pmessage', pmessageHandler); this.receiver.psubscribe(this.prefix + channel, callback); var removeListener = function(callback){ self.receiver.removeListener('pmessage', pmessageHandler); return self.receiver.punsubscribe(self.prefix + channel, callback); }; return removeListener; }; /** * Emit an event * @param {String} channel Channel on which to emit the message * @param {Object} message */ NodeRedisPubsub.prototype.emit = NodeRedisPubsub.prototype.publish = function (channel, message) { return this.emitter.publish(this.prefix + channel, JSON.stringify(message)); }; /** * Safely close the redis connections 'soon' */ NodeRedisPubsub.prototype.quit = function() { this.emitter.quit(); this.receiver.quit(); }; /** * Dangerously close the redis connections immediately */ NodeRedisPubsub.prototype.end = function() { this.emitter.end(true); this.receiver.end(true); }; module.exports = NodeRedisPubsub;
